摘要
以玉米芯为主要原料,通过单因素和正交试验对绿色木霉HY-7液体发酵产纤维素酶的最佳工艺条件进行优化。结果表明,最佳产酶条件为:250mL三角瓶添加Mandels无机营养液75mL,添加玉米芯2.0%,蛋白胨0.05%,吐温800.1%,调整pH值为5.0;菌龄78h,接种量4.0%,转速150r/min,28℃恒温振荡培养102h,该条件下,其酶活为401.7u/mL,比优化前提高了44.6%。
Through single factor test and orthogonal experiments, the technical conditions of liquid fermentation of corn cob by trichoderma viride HY-07 to produce cellulase were optimized. The optimum conditions for cellulase yield were summed up as follows: 75 mL Mandels inorganic nutrition liquid was added in 250 mL flask with, then 2.0 % corn cob, 0.05 % peptone, and 0.1% Tween80 were added, then pH value adjusted to 5.0 with seed age as 78 h and 4.0 % inoculation quantity, then the rotation speed was at 150 r/min, and after 102 h culture at 28℃, the activity of the produced cellulase reached 401.7 u/mL, 44.6 % higher than that produced by unoptimizable techniques.
